Hopx is a transcription co-factor expressed during lung development and we wanted to profile Hopx +/+ and -/- embyonic lungs. Results inform the role of Hopx in embryonic lung development Overall design: We used microarrays to profile the transcriptome of Hopx -/- lungs compared to Hopx +/+ lungs. Lungs were microdissected and three biological replicates were used for each genotype.
